David Linthicum, ebizQ blogger and CEO of BridgeWERX, joins a high-level panel here at InfoWorld's SOA Executive Forum, discussing where we are in the different stacks and the status of standards and standards organizations in the integration space.
The panel sort of agreed that the trouble with standards right now is that there are now no base protocols, no fully developed programs that encompass all that standards could be. But Dave said, "Every SOA out there is different. So that this notion that we could have this stack, or one set of standards for SOA, is ABSURD. Understand that if you're going to get into this game you're going to have to spend a lot of time understanding your own requirements.
"The architectures have different needs, different specs, and there's no way to standardize this. This isn't really my opinion, it's fact," Dave said.
Dave was asked when he thinks the time will be right for standards. Here are some of his comments:
"I'm sort of the Wilford Brimley of the SOA world. I'm telling you it's hard when the marketing people are saying it's easy. The people who write to my blog and send me emails and call in to the podcast, they're confused.
"I'm very bullish on standards. But today there are standards being created for the selfish needs of the vendors. And the reality of it if you want to get into a space is that you develop the technology, then write the standard, and then try to get it adopted by a standards body. It's inhibiting the growth of the market.
"What needs to happen is that the user communities need to push back on the number and confusion of standards. Should probably have single instances of standards, come to an agreement of what needs to be in the stack.
"Going forward, I'm seeing another disturbing trend. There are standards that exist that are not yet fully developed. BPEL is an example of this. Using Oracle or IBM BPEL stacks, they are not going to have portability from stack to stack. It's very disturbing that the biggest companies are doing this."